The Otay Water District is soliciting bids for the interior and exterior coating and structural upgrades of the 1485-1 Reservoir, a 0.3 million-gallon, above-ground, welded steel reservoir built in 1962 located in Spring Valley, California. The scope requires full removal and disposal of existing coatings, surface preparation to SSPC-SP10 near-white metal standards on all interior and exterior surfaces including ceiling, rafters, columns, shells, floor, roof, and appurtenances, followed by application of new protective coatings. Additional work includes installation of new magnesium anodes, a 10-inch steel overflow pipe, a 1-inch corporation stop with locking metal box, safety climb systems, OSHA-compliant safety gates, roof railing, and structural modifications. All materials must be delivered in original, unopened containers with full manufacturer markings, batch/lot numbers, and date of manufacture, and Material Safety Data Sheets must be provided for all chemicals. Work must comply with AWWA D100 and API 650 standards, with interior dehumidification during coating and curing and thorough flushing with potable water upon completion. The project is subject to California public contract laws, including prevailing wage requirements, apprentice utilization, and labor non-discrimination provisions. Bids are due by 4:00 PM local time on August 24, 2026, and must be submitted exclusively through the PlanetBids portal. The award will be made to the lowest responsive and responsible bidder based on bid items 1 through 27, with no weighted scoring factors. Mandatory submittals include a bid bond of at least 10% of the bid amount, performance and payment bonds for 100% of the contract value issued by a California-admitted surety with a Best rating of A VII or better, and proof of insurance including $5 million commercial general liability, $1 million business auto liability, and statutory workers’ compensation with employer’s liability coverage of at least $1 million per occurrence. Insurance policies must name the District as an additional insured and be primary. Contractors must submit safety plans and qualifications of a safety supervisor for approval before starting work, and must certify in writing that no coatings contain prohibited VOCs such as PCE, TCE, or MEK. Contractors must provide calibrated inspection tools on-site for dry film thickness and holiday testing, which will be verified by an independent AMPP PCS Level 3 inspector hired by the District
